Original warning text
BRAZIL-SOUTH COAST. 1. SEISMIC SURVEY IN PROGRESS UNTIL 06 MAY BY M/V DISCOVERER IN AREA BOUND BY 35-10S 049-02W, 35-13S 049-06W, 35-18S 049-08W, 33-34S 052-11W, 33-32S 052-10W, 33-31S 052-11W, 33-28S 052-11W, 33-28S 052-05W, 33-24S 052-03W, 33-42S 048-56W, 33-45S 048-56W, 33-48S 048-56W. FIVE MILE BERTH REQUESTED. 2. CANCEL THIS MSG 07 MAY.
